The Transformative Power of Jesus' Blood

Lucía Parker's song "Es La Sangre de Jesús" is a powerful testament to the transformative and redemptive power of Jesus Christ's blood. The lyrics emphasize that there is nothing one can do to stop the healing and restorative power of Jesus' blood. It speaks to the idea that no illness, guilt, or anxiety is beyond the reach of this divine intervention. The song portrays Jesus' blood as a force that can restore the inner self and heal broken hearts, highlighting its profound spiritual significance.

The recurring theme of Jesus' blood as a source of victory and transformation is central to the song. Parker describes it as the blood of the Lamb of Glory, which changed her story out of love. This blood flows with power and has never known defeat, even conquering death itself. The imagery of a crimson river that eternally flows within the believer underscores the idea of continuous and everlasting grace and redemption. The song conveys a deep sense of gratitude and reverence for the cleansing and renewing power of Jesus' blood.

The lyrics also reflect a personal and intimate connection with Jesus. Parker sings about how Jesus' blood has cleansed her of all evil, pain, and guilt, filling her with a sense of purity and renewal. The song acknowledges that there is no place where one can hide from the precious blood of Christ, emphasizing its omnipresence and all-encompassing nature. The repeated question and answer format in the latter part of the song reinforces the belief that only Jesus' blood can offer forgiveness and a new heart, making it a central tenet of Christian faith and worship.
